Android Volley, JsonObjectRequest 但收到 JsonArray
全部标签 我在如何在asp.net中成功设置androidgcm和相关服务器端工作方面取得了成功。但我的问题是,它只显示服务器发送的最后一条通知。我希望显示的所有通知都来自同一个collapse_key或者我在gcm代码或服务器端代码中更改的内容,以显示发送到特定设备的所有消息。服务器端的代码如下publicvoidSendCommandToPhone(StringsCommand){StringDeviceID="";DeviceID="APA91bF9SSDEp-UPU8UwvctGt5ogfrSw0UdilTWlCujqItHcr-eiPJ31ZDI-IeqTbLr92ZOPF31bXtB
这是我从网络服务得到的结果"year":["2014","2013","2012","2011","2010","2009","2008","2007","2006","2005","2004","2003","2002","2001","2000","1999","1998","1997","1996","1995","1994","1993","1992","1991","1990","1989","1988","1987","1986","1985","1984","1983","1982","1981","1980","1979","1978","1977","1976","1
我已将Android应用程序连接到GoogleFirebase云消息服务(FCM),遵循thisguide,我关注了thisanswer设置FCM和AWSSNS之间的连接.我可以成功收到来自FCMconsole的消息但不是来自AWSSNSconsole.留言deliverystatus登录AWS显示我发送的每条消息都成功,而我的设备上没有显示任何通知。有没有办法检查发生了什么? 最佳答案 我遇到了完全相同的问题,来自Firebase的带有设备token的消息有效,但不知何故,从SNS到Firebase的消息没有传递。我也开发了iOS
我正在尝试通过套接字将图像从我的安卓设备发送到我的电脑。问题是我计算机上的输入流读取了每个字节,但最后一组字节除外。我试过修剪字节数组并发送它,我多次手动将-1写入输出流,但输入流从未读取-1。它只是挂起等待数据。我也试过不关闭流或套接字以查看是否是某种计时问题,但效果不佳。客户端(安卓手机)//ThishastobeanobjectoutputstreambecauseIwriteobjectstoitfirstInputStreamis=Animage'sinputstreamandroidObjectOutputStreamobjectOutputStream=newObject
我想在JSonArray中的特定位置添加一个对象。我当前的JsonArray看起来像这样{"imgs":["String1","String2","String3","String4"]}我需要像这样在jsonarray的第一个位置再插入一个项目-jsonArray.put(1,"String5")这是替换第一个位置的项目但我需要以下结果{"imgs":["String1","String5","String2","String3","String4"]}请推荐 最佳答案 看起来太老了,但你可以这样做:publicvoidaddTo
我想将JSONArray从Activity传递到HTMLScript我正在尝试以下方式,但我无法获取数据在里面HTMLActivity:-publicclassDayViewJSActivityextendsActivity{WebViewwebviewobj;Stringjsurl,eventobj;JSONArrayjArray=newJSONArray();/**Calledwhentheactivityisfirstcreated.*/@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(sav
在我的项目属性中,我有Android2.2,团队中的另一个人能够很好地构建。我在res->values下的themes.xml文件中收到错误ErrorRetrievingparentforitem:Noresourcefoundthatmatchesthegivenname'@android:style/Theme.Dialog.Alert'.因此我无法构建我的项目。这是一个正确的项目,我从SVN存储库获取并导入到Eclipse中。@style/DA.TextView 最佳答案 我遇到了同样的问题。尝试增加list文件中的min-s
我有一个Bound服务,每15分钟收集一次3分钟的位置信息。在ServiceConnection的onServiceConnected中连接服务后,我将启动一个CountDownTimer。我收到所有定时器回调(onFinish)(onTick)就bindService可见的Activity而言是完美的。当设备被锁定时,我不会从计时器收到任何更新。我的位置服务publicclassMyLocationServiceextendsServiceimplementsMyTimerListener{privateIBindermBinder=newMyLocationBinder();pub
我从客户那里收到了一个keystore文件,我应该用它来签署一个APK,该APK将替换/更新Play商店中的现有APK。不幸的是,我收到以下错误:jarsigner:Certificatechainnotfoundfor:alias_name.alias_namemustreferenceavalidKeyStorekeyentrycontainingaprivatekeyandcorrespondingpublickeycertificatechain.当我尝试使用不同的、自生成的keystore签署同一个APK时,这工作正常,所以我认为keystore中一定缺少某些东西。Keyst
我正在使用GCM在我的应用程序上获取通知。为此,我在登录和注册时生成注册ID。在登录或注册过程后,它会抛出onRecieve方法的空点异常错误。这个错误有时会出现,有时不会出现。这是错误的日志。01-1512:26:02.93522448-22448/com.simplerW/System.err:java.lang.NullPointerException:Attempttoinvokevirtualmethod'voidandroid.content.BroadcastReceiver.onReceive(android.content.Context,android.conten